The Real Price Tag of 100 kVA Solar Systems

When business owners first ask about 100 kVA solar power plant cost, they're usually shocked by the $40,000-$80,000 range. But here's the kicker - that upfront price only tells half the story. Last month, a Texas brewery discovered their projected $62,000 system actually required $18,000 in grid upgrades nobody mentioned initially.

Wait, no - let's clarify. The core components breakdown typically looks like this:

  • Photovoltaic panels (45-60% of total cost)
  • Inverters (12-18%)
  • Mounting structures (8-12%)
  • Balance of systems (5-8%)

What No One Tells You About Installation

Permitting headaches. Soil testing nightmares. Interconnection queue limbo. These hidden factors can add 20-35% to your 100 kva solar system price. A recent case study showed a Colorado farm waiting 14 months for utility approval - that's 14 months of potential savings gone!
